Taranda

Taranda is a village located in Nizar taluka of Tapi district in Gujarat, India. It is situated 30km away from sub-district headquarter Nizar (tehsildar office) and 130km away from district headquarter Vyara. As per 2009 stats, Taranda village is also a gram panchayat.

About Taranda

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Taranda is 524433. The village spans a total geographical area of 350.34 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 394380. Akkalkuva is nearest town to Taranda village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 7km away.

Population of Taranda

According to the 2011 Census, Taranda has a total population of about 1,596, with approximately 765 males and 831 females. The sex ratio is around 1086 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 222 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 1,587. The overall literacy rate is approximately 54.14%, with male literacy at about 62.48% and female literacy near 46.45%. There are around 337 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Taranda's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,596 765 831
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 222 107 115
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 1,587 762 825
Literate Population 864 478 386
Illiterate Population 732 287 445

Connectivity of Taranda

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Taranda. As per the 2011 stats, Taranda had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
